Just kidding. -- Mats I've been uploading audio in ogg for years. http://www.lazygranch.com/red_audio.htm http://www.lazygranch.com/janet_audio.htm While not much of an advantage for mono, ogg is very useful for stereo scanner recording. That is, you record two scanners in real time. MP3 will share the audio between channels, while ogg behaves as if each channel is discrete. I try to use open source standards where possible, i.e. LAME or Ogg versus mp3. FLAC versus whatever crap Apple is pushing lately. |
